10 Golden Tips for First-Time Boat Vacationers

One of the favorite activities of vacationers is undoubtedly the boat tour. We also wanted to write down everything you need for a boat tour one by one under the title of recommendations for those who will take a boat vacation. As it is known, boat tours are one of the most popular holiday types of today.

Some people like natural areas, some like historical areas, some like the vast seas. Boat vacation, which is one of the most ideal holiday types for sea lovers, can be preferred because it is both enjoyable and more affordable in terms of activity as a group. Here are some sub-headings that should be considered for those who will take a boat holiday for the first time:

1) Make the Boat Reservation from a Reliable Company

For your boat holiday, it would be right to contact a boat rental company at first. You should not forget that your options are very wide when it comes to boat rental. In this sense, private boat rental companies offer different options to their guests, both in terms of price and comfort. It would be useful to do a detailed research to make sure which boat best meets your needs. You can also benefit from the comments of people who have rented a boat before.

You can also provide your private boat rental business directly in the holiday city you go to, but thanks to the reservations you will make in advance, you can both benefit financially and be sure that you have agreed with the right company. If you agree with a well-known and reliable boat rental company, you will not encounter any disappointments later.

2) Don't Compromise Your Onboard Comfort

Be sure to learn all the details about the boat. The equipment, belongings, open-to-use toilets and bathrooms in your cabin must be checked. Since the cabin is the comfort zone of the guests, the more comfortable and spacious your cabin is, the more you will be able to enjoy your holiday. For this reason, when renting a boat, try to learn extra information about the cabin. Ask for photos of your cabin, if possible, to avoid disappointment later. Some yacht charter companies photograph all the details of the yacht and send them to you. However, if there is none, you should not neglect to ask for it.

3) Make Sure You Have The Necessary Materials In Your Suitcase

Although it is quite enjoyable to pack a suitcase for the holiday, sometimes even the most necessary materials are forgotten. For this reason, you should take care to keep the materials that will be useful for your blue cruise trip in your bags. Among them, it is possible to count many things from sunscreen to sunglasses, from hats to clothes, from beach towels to magazines. However, since this will be a boat holiday, it would be more logical to choose products for the sea and the sun. You should be careful not to forget to take your medicine with extra clothes, slippers and if you are using it.

4) Avoid Situations That Will Put Your Health At Risk For The Boat Tour

Of course, health comes first. Especially in the summer season, it is necessary to be much more careful. It may not be possible to find everything you need in terms of health in the rental boat. If you are allergic to anything during the summer months, it is important to take your precautions accordingly. For example, if there is a special allergy to sea water and sun rays, it would be beneficial to embark on your blue cruise adventure by taking into account the recommendations of your doctor.

5) Make Sure You Get the Right Clothes and Equipment

Slippers and sandals are naturally worn rather than shoes during the summer holidays. It will be beneficial for you to buy slippers with spares, if possible, so that you can move freely on the boat. In addition, if you like diving, it is recommended that you have the indispensable clothes of the summer months, such as diving equipment, swimwear, and shorts. In addition to these, you may need to buy extra clothes in case it can be cold in the evenings.

6) Don't Forget Your Children's Needs

If you have children or if you are taking a child with you, you should definitely buy sunscreen or lotion suitable for children after you have rented a boat. However, you should also check if there are life jackets for children on board. Since the needs of children may be different from those of adults, a separate list should be made of the items that should be bought for the child.

7) If You Have Pets, Pay Attention to These

If your pet is going on a yacht trip with you, you should not forget that his needs are also a priority. You should definitely reserve a place for your pet in your list of recommendations for those who will take a boat vacation. You can meet your pet's toilet needs by going ashore during breaks. However, you should not forget to buy an extra pet toilet and deodorizer just in case.

In order for your pet to have a more comfortable and comfortable space, it will be beneficial to cut their nails. Animals love to play. However, if their nails are not trimmed, they can unintentionally damage the flooring on the yacht. Another important detail is your pet's hair. Make sure to shorten the hairs. Otherwise, it may be possible for him to be overwhelmed by the heat. In addition to providing a shaded area for your animal, you should not forget to take plenty of water and food.

8) Be Cautious Against Pests

One of the most common problems in the summer months is undoubtedly the pest problem. Wherever you are, it is not possible to escape the torture of mosquitoes. For this reason, if you do not want this beautiful blue tour to be poisonous, you should always take care to have mosquito repellent spray with you. If you wish, you can do a regular cleaning for your room every day. Apart from this, there are also creams and lotions that protect against mosquitoes. By taking these with you, you can protect both yourself and your children against mosquitoes in the best way.

9) If You Say You Can't Do Without a Phone, Don't Forget to Buy a Powerbank

If you want to take photos of the places you go and share them with your friends, you need to ensure that your mobile phone is charged. For this, it would be most logical to carry a Powerbank. Powerbank will be a life saver for you, especially in the open sea where you may experience charging problems. In this way, you can take pictures or videos with your phone and communicate with your loved ones with the Powerbank without the need for an extra charge.

10) Take Games With You For Fun

Within the scope of the boat tour, you will see many different activities. However, there are different board games, ludo, okey, playing cards, etc. to play with your family or friends. You can take. In this way, you can make your night even more colorful on long nights, especially if you are out at sea.
